Singapore’s climate — warm, humid, constant — is not kind to homes left to drift. Unlike temperate regions where seasonal changes bring natural ventilation and drying periods, tropical environments present challenges that require active, informed maintenance.

Consider what is actually happening in your home, often unseen:

  • Moisture accumulation — Water finds its way into grout lines, beneath floorboards, behind bathroom tiles, and into corners that are wiped but not properly treated. In Singapore’s humidity, what appears clean can still be harbouring conditions for damage.
  • Mold establishment — Mold grows in the spaces between cleanings, establishing itself in bathroom corners, kitchen seals, and areas of limited airflow. By the time it becomes visible, it has often been developing for months.
  • Surface deterioration — The stone countertops, hardwood floors, and premium fixtures you selected with such care age unevenly depending on how consistently and correctly they are maintained. Improper cleaning products can strip sealants. Inadequate attention can allow etching, staining, and wear that proper care would have prevented.
  • Appliance strain — Residue accumulates in ventilation systems, refrigerators, and air conditioning units when maintenance is inconsistent. This affects performance, efficiency, and longevity.
  • Pest vulnerability — Issues that could be identified early by a trained eye are often discovered only when the damage has become structural — and significantly more expensive to address.

How to Choose a Housekeeping Partner in Singapore

Not all professional housekeeping services are created equal. The difference between genuine professional care and surface-level cleaning can be substantial — in both immediate results and long-term impact on your home.

When evaluating providers, consider these factors:

Standards and Consistency

  • Does the service apply the same standards every visit, regardless of staffing changes?
  • Are team members trained in material-appropriate care, not just general cleaning?
  • Is there quality assurance to ensure consistency over time?

Reliability and Accountability

  • Can you count on scheduled visits happening as planned?
  • Is there clear communication and responsive support when questions arise?
  • Does the service operate as a professional organisation with systems, or as an informal arrangement?

Range of Capabilities

  • Can the provider address regular ongoing care as well as deeper cleaning needs?
  • Do they understand how to care for the specific materials in your home — stone, wood, quality fixtures, upholstery?
  • Is there support for the practical demands that extend beyond routine cleaning?

Approach and Philosophy

  • Does the service position itself as a professional maintenance partner, or as interchangeable with any other cleaner?
  • Do they speak about your home as an asset to be protected, or simply a space to be tidied?
  • Is there evidence of the thoughtfulness and thoroughness that protects what you have built?
